What Does Tuning an Engine Do for Performance?

Engine Tuning: What It Really Does

Tuning an engine is one of those terms that gets thrown around a lot in the automotive world. But what does it actually mean? Simply put, tuning an engine involves adjusting various parameters to optimize its performance. This can lead to better horsepower, improved fuel efficiency, and a more responsive driving experience. Let’s break down what tuning an engine does and why it matters.

What Does Tuning an Engine Do?

When you tune an engine, you’re essentially recalibrating its systems to work more efficiently. Here are some key aspects of what tuning can achieve:


  • Increased Horsepower: One of the primary goals of tuning is to boost the engine’s power output. By adjusting fuel delivery, ignition timing, and air intake, you can unlock more horsepower.

  • Improved Torque: Torque is crucial for acceleration. Tuning can enhance torque delivery across the RPM range, making the vehicle feel more responsive.

  • Better Fuel Economy: Believe it or not, a well-tuned engine can actually save you money at the pump. By optimizing the air-fuel mixture and ignition timing, you can achieve better fuel efficiency.

  • Enhanced Throttle Response: A tuned engine often responds more quickly to throttle inputs, giving you a more engaging driving experience.

  • Reduced Emissions: Tuning can help in meeting emission standards by ensuring the engine burns fuel more completely.

How is Engine Tuning Done?

There are several methods to tune an engine, each with its own set of advantages and disadvantages. Here’s a quick rundown:


  1. ECU Remapping: This involves altering the software in the engine control unit (ECU) to change how the engine operates. It’s one of the most common methods for tuning modern vehicles.

  2. Aftermarket Parts: Installing performance parts like cold air intakes, exhaust systems, and turbochargers can significantly enhance engine performance.

  3. Dyno Tuning: Using a dynamometer, a mechanic can measure the engine’s output and make precise adjustments to maximize performance.

  4. Mechanical Adjustments: This includes changing components like camshafts, valves, and fuel injectors to improve performance.

Why Tuning Matters

Tuning isn’t just about making your car faster; it’s about making it work better. A well-tuned engine runs more smoothly, responds quicker, and can even last longer. However, it’s crucial to approach tuning with caution. Over-tuning can lead to engine damage, so it’s essential to know your limits and work with a qualified mechanic.

Whether you’re looking to squeeze out a bit more power for the track or just want a more enjoyable drive, tuning can make a significant difference. Just remember, it’s not a one-size-fits-all solution; what works for one engine might not work for another.
